See You at Work Tomorrow! — Watch on Prime Video June 22, 2026

In this summer show, Cha Ji-yoon has totally sworn off dating after a breakup shattered her. But when company team leader Kang Si-woo enters her life, everything changes. Workplace romances for the win!
Elle — Watch on Prime Video July 1, 2026

We're going back to LA in the 1990s for this Legally Blonde prequel...and then immediately heading to Seattle. Elle isn't exactly the most popular girl in her new northwestern school, but she's the key to unearthing a whole school conspiracy, whether her new friends like it or not.
Murder 101 — Watch on Prime Video July 13, 2026

A sociology class in a Tennessee high school decide to take on one of the past's most intriguing cold cases — and end up uncovering brand new leads no one expected.
Ride or Die — Watch on Prime Video July 15, 2026

Octavia Spencer and Hannah Waddingham are teaming up for a new summer show where they play best friends...except one of them is hiding a major secret: she's an assassin. After a hit gone (very) wrong, the BFF's are left to fend for themselves in Europe.
